Ellsworth Air Force Base, S.D. -- The principal purpose of the Airman Retraining Program is to maintain an equilibrium of manpower across all Air Force specialty codes (AFSCs). The program allows Airmen to retrain into career fields to alleviate manpower shortages. The total survey sample included 682 responses.Performance Assessment. - 414 CTS multifunctional team lead; identified replication of custodial services--net contract savings of $175K. - Coordinated convoy transport route through Emirate area; 8 prefab bldgs delivered to US site without incident. - Engineered new SF msn manpower; validated 64 add'l rqmts/$4M for AFIMSC FY17 prgming--ABW ...Air Force manpower standards are developed using an approach described in AFMAN 38- 102, 2019. The scope of a standard or other manpower determinant is a function, defined as A group of personnel that use similar machines, processes, methods, and operations to do homogeneous work usually located in a centralized area.

Air Force Specialty Code (AFSC). A combination of alpha-numeric characters which are used to identify a specific career field and qualification level for Air Force officers and enlisted personnel. Air Force Specialty Manager (AFSM). An individual on HQ USAF staff, responsible to the AFCFM for overseeing all aspects of a particular AFS (1N8X1).

A United States military occupation code, or a military occupational specialty code (MOS code), is a nine-character code used in the United States Army and United States Marine Corps to identify a specific job. In the United States Air Force, a system of Air Force Specialty Codes (AFSC) is used.
